Final Score: VCU 5, Lock Haven 0
Location:Â Lock Haven, Pa.
Records:Â VCU 11-2 (4-1 A-10), Lock Haven (4-8, 2-3)
Â
The Short Story:Â
Mora Marrero made an early statement with a third minute goal as VCU dominated in the wire-to-wire shutout victory.
Â
QUICK FACTS:
- VCU has won seven straight games, outscoring opponents by a combined 22-3 over that span
- Mora Marrero scored twice on just three shot attempts
- Camila Rosenbrock, Skyler Padgett and Mackenzie white each scored once
- It marked the first collegiate goal for White
- Josephine Jense and Georgia Carr-Brown each recorded an assist in the victory
- VCU outshot Lock Haven 15-6 overall and 12-3 in shots on goal
- Sheridan Messier made two saves to earn another shutout win. It marked VCU's sixth shutout of the season
Â
HOW IT HAPPENED:
- Marrero got an early breakaway in the third minute, beating the goalkeeper to the right to put VCU up 1-0 early
- Early in the second half, Padgett was able to tap in a pass at the back post from Jense to put VCU up 2-0 in the 35th minute
- The Rams went up 3-0 in the 42nd minute as Marrero intercepted a pass in VCU's own end and sprinted clear of the Lock Haven defense to score on a breakaway
- White scored her first goal in the 56th minute, tapping in her own rebound after a scramble in front of the goal
- Rosenbrock scored the final goal in the 59th minute, scoring from the top of the circle to the near post after getting a pass from Carr-Brown
